Description

Ibuprofen provides rapid relief by reducing pain, inflammation, and fever. It is effective for a variety of conditions including headaches, backache, mild arthritis, menstrual pain, muscle pain, dental pain, rheumatic pain, cold and flu symptoms, migraines, neuralgia, and fever.

Suitable for adults and children over 12

 

Warnings

 

Do not take Ibuprofen tablets if you:

  • Are allergic to ibuprofen, any other NSAID, aspirin, or any ingredients in this medicine (listed in section 6). Allergic reactions may include swelling of the eyelids, lips, tongue, or throat.
  • Have experienced worsening asthma symptoms, hayfever, itchy rash (urticaria), or swelling under the skin (angioedema) when taking ibuprofen, aspirin, or similar painkillers.
  • Currently have or have had a stomach ulcer or bleeding in the stomach on two previous occasions.
  • Have ever had perforation or bleeding in the gut when taking any NSAID.
  • Suffer from severe liver, kidney, or heart problems.
  • Are in the last three months of pregnancy.
  • Have abnormal bleeding or problems with abnormal bruising.
  • Are currently taking mifamurtide (a medication used to treat bone cancer).

Warnings and precautions 

Take special care with Ibuprofen caplets if you :

 • Are elderly, as you may be more prone to side effects  which in some cases may be extremely serious or even life threatening

 • Have a history of asthma or other allergy disorders

 • Have liver, kidney, or bowel problems

 • Have Systemic Lupus Erythematosus (SLE), a condition of the immune system resulting in joint pains, skin rashes, kidney or liver problems

 • Have or have had high blood pressure or heart problems. Speak to your doctor who will advise you on your treatment and may wish to monitor you

 • Have a history of bleeding in the stomach or gut. Speak to your doctor immediately if you notice any problems with your stomach, especially at the start of your treatment

 • Smoke

 • Have an infection, as symptoms such as fever, pain and swelling may be masked

• Are a child with chickenpox

 • Are in the first 6 months of your pregnancy

• Are taking other NSAID painkillers including a specific type called COX-2 inhibitors, or aspirin, with a daily dose above 75mg

• If you are on low-dose aspirin (up to 75mg).

Side Effects

Serious skin reactions have been reported with Ibuprofen caplets. If you develop any skin rash, mucous membrane lesions, blisters, or other signs of an allergic reaction, stop taking Ibuprofen caplets and seek medical attention immediately, as these could be early indicators of a severe skin reaction. Additionally, dehydrated adolescents are at risk of kidney impairment.
